Light effect bar (50 cm) with UV LEDsThe powerful and dimmable light effect bar EUROLITE LED BAR-6 UV is equipped with six 1 W UV LEDs. Due to the convection cooling, the LED BAR is noiseless and offers you versatile application possibilities. Whether at events or for band performances - whether in the theatre or at galas - the LED Bar-6 UV is variably applicable. It is controlled via DMX, master-slave operation is also possible. The LED Bar also has a phantom-powered USB socket for a QuickDMX receiver. This is optionally available. In auto and music mode you can also use integrated show programs. Addressing and settings can be made via the integrated control unit with 4-digit LED display. The mains connections allow you to operate up to eight devices in a row.
